About North West Air Ambulance
We're a lifesaving and life-changing charity in the North West of England.
Our crews bring enhanced pre-hospital care and medical interventions to the scene, giving patients the best chance, often where seconds can mean the difference between life and death.
With three helicopters and four critical care cars, we operate day and night, 365 days a year, and serve the largest population in the UK, outside of London, but it costs £18 million annually to keep us in the air and on the road.
And here’s the challenge: we receive no government or NHS funding. Every mission we fly is funded entirely by the generosity of our supporters.

Online Sales Assistant
Please apply with your CV
Join a Life-Saving Crew
At the North West Air Ambulance Charity (NWAA), we deliver advanced pre-hospital care that can mean the difference between life and death. When every second counts, our specialist team is there, by air and by road, to provide critical emergency treatment.
As a charity, we’re constantly evolving. By embracing innovation and adapting to change, we’ve transformed the way we work, increasing our reach and improving patient outcomes. But we’re not stopping there. We’re committed to developing and enhancing our service to continue saving lives, every day.
Are you passionate about making a difference and skilled in online sales? We're looking for a motivated Online Sales Assistant to support our charity’s online shop and help generate vital income that supports our life-saving work.
LOCATION: Speke
WORKING HOURS: 35 hours per week
SALARY: £22,993
Overall purpose of the role:
The Online Sales Assistant is responsible for selling donated and new stock online to maximise profit for the Charity. Organise products in the warehouse, photograph, list and accurately describe online to advertise and sell. Package and dispatch items to customers.
Main duties and responsibilities:
• Effectively process stock, ensuring that accurate records are maintained and any discrepancies are logged and managed.
• Organise product storage in the warehouse in line with procedure.
• Photograph products with the use of a digital camera
• Research items online to ensure items are listed accurately, with the correct price, and associated search words.
• Catalogue and accurately list products ensuring all details are accurately displayed.
• Respond to customer queries on the telephone and online in a quick and efficient manner, in line with service level expectations.
• Ensure that the number of listings meet the agreed targets and are completed to a high standard.
• Ensure sold products are posted out to customers in an efficient manner, in line with agreed protocols to maximise income and minimise stock holding for the Charity.
• Act as a role model for volunteers, assessing their skills and potential, and training them as needed to ensure that their value is recognised.
• Support marketing campaigns, stock generation and sales promotions to increase sales.
• Ensure that any complaints received are correctly recorded and responded to in line with the agreed protocols and timelines.
• Support the Online Manager in producing reports regarding sales, complaints and the profitability of the online shop.
